PositionScore must be a NUMBER ! (It is of course documented in the manual).

If you don't define position score then
backtester picks NOT randomly but according to the following rules:
a) prefer largest position SIZE first
then
b) alphabetical order (if same position size)
then
b) prefer LONG over SHORT (if both occur for same symbol at the same time)

> Using daily timeframe, I have a day when i have 90 buy signals on
> different stocks. I set "Max Open Positions" to 10 in AA settings to
> limit to 10 stocks per day. I do not have positionscore set anywhere
> in my AFL code. My understanding is that this should by default result
> in only the top 10 stocks *alphabetically* showing up if i run a
> backtest. However, when i run the backtest, i get a seemingly random
> set of 10 stocks showing up in the backtest, not the top ones
> alphabetically (ie not the ones starting with A... then B... then C...
> etc)
> 
> Also, if I set 
> 
> Positionscore=Name();
> 
> I still dont get alphabetical positionscoring, but if i set
> 
> Positionscore=Close;
> 
> it works and i get only the 10 highest-priced stocks bought for that day.
> 
> Anybody know why this is happening?
